‘From Adirè to Jadirè – A Transition of Textile Culture from Southwest Nigeria to Jamaica’ will unfold at The University of the West Indies Regional Headquarters as a variety of Jadire (batik fabrics). 

From Wednesday, November 17 to Saturday, December 2, four Jadirè fabric graduates (Jacquline Mason Reid, Nella Stewart, Simone Gordon and Charmaine Brown), who have developed a Jadire-production business from their training are hosting an expose of batik fabrics and many items made from such.

The Things Jamaican brand takes the spotlight on the new date Friday, November 24 with a grand 60th Anniversary Celebration & Early Christmas Trade Show.

Over sixty producers and sellers of authentic Jamaican products will gather at the JBDC Corporate office to mount a display of products in the following categories: Food, Fashion, Fashion Accessories, Aromatherapy, Home & Home Accents and Souvenirs. The event will also feature product samples, discounts, and giveaways.
